Abstract
A wrist-forearm-elbow anti-rotation support system and process that do not require a hardenable material. The system includes an orthopedic support such as a wrist-hand orthosis, wrist-hand-thumb orthosis, joined to a bottle-shaped forearm wrap with opposed flaps formed into a clamshell. Proximal elbow flaps include a center elbow region that extends from the proximal end of the forearm wrap. Attaching straps and/or cross straps extending from the proximal elbow flaps attach to the forearm flaps and may crisscross. Hook and loop fasteners extending from the distal edge of the forearm wrap attach the forearm flaps.
